Transaction 7c14cf93a74aa46dc7c466fb759aeb4243865b083098628d176fc1374976897e
1 Input
1 Output
-
7c14cf93a74aa46dc7c466fb759aeb4243865b083098628d176fc1374976897e:0
- value
- 666931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b27394c69d612bb550997691d21fcb85d568f84 OP_EQUAL
- address
- 3LDC5obqRe756i8QGkESGqnLF5K51M6SVq